This home in brief

24 Richmond Croft is a freehold terraced house on Richmond Croft in B42. It last sold for £118,000 in 2006 — its 2nd recorded sale, up 24% on its first recorded sale of £95,000 in 2006. Its EPC records 80 m² of floor space — about £1,475 per square metre at that last price, 43% below the recent B42 norm. For context, B42's median over the last 8 years is £193,000 — this home's last sale was 39% lower.
